Traditional British usage assigned new names for each power of one million (the long scale): 1,000,000 = 1 million; 1,000,000 2 = 1 billion; 1,000,000 3 = 1 trillion; and so on. It was adapted from French usage, and is similar to the system that was documented or invented by Chuquet. WebJan 30, 2024 · Also, we know that one billion is written as 1,000,000,000. It has 9 zeroes after the 1. If we multiply 1000 with one billion, the answer will be one trillion. See below: One thousand × One Billion = One Trillion 1000 × 1,000,000,000 = 1,000,000,000,000 It means that there are one thousand billion in one trillion. WebOne billion is equivalent to thousand million.
